Where Your Body Stores Fat Matters More Than How Much

Visceral fat behaves differently from the fat you can pinch — and it is the compartment that drives metabolic risk.

Body fat isn’t one tissue doing one job in one place. It’s distributed, and the distribution carries more information about metabolic risk than the total.

Two people can carry the same amount of fat and face meaningfully different risk profiles based on where that fat sits.

Two kinds of storage

Subcutaneous fat sits directly beneath the skin. It’s the fat you can pinch — on the hips, thighs, arms, and the surface of the abdomen. It functions largely as intended: a reserve of stored energy, insulation, and cushioning.

Visceral fat sits deeper, inside the abdominal cavity, packed around the liver, pancreas, and intestines. You can’t pinch it. Someone can carry a significant amount while appearing only modestly heavy — or, in some cases, while appearing lean.

The two behave differently, and that difference is the point.

Why visceral fat behaves differently

Visceral fat is metabolically active tissue. It releases signaling molecules — inflammatory cytokines and hormones — into circulation, and it drains directly into the portal vein, which delivers blood to the liver first.

That anatomy matters. Fatty acids and inflammatory signals released from visceral fat reach the liver at high concentration before dispersing through the rest of the body. The liver is central to glucose regulation and lipid production, so a steady load arriving at its doorstep influences both.

Visceral fat is consistently associated with insulin resistance, elevated triglycerides, higher blood pressure, and markers of systemic inflammation. Subcutaneous fat shows a much weaker relationship with these, and fat stored in the hips and thighs appears in some analyses to be neutral or even mildly protective.

This is why waist circumference predicts metabolic risk better than weight does. It’s a rough measure of the compartment that matters.

Thin on the outside

There’s a group this framework explains particularly well: people who look lean, have an unremarkable BMI, and still show metabolic dysfunction on labs.

Often the pattern involves relatively high visceral fat combined with low muscle mass. The scale reads normal because there isn’t much tissue overall. The metabolic picture reads poorly because the fat that is present is in the wrong compartment and there’s little muscle to help absorb glucose.

These people are frequently missed. Nothing about their appearance triggers a metabolic workup, and no standard screening asks the question.

What drives visceral accumulation

Total energy balance matters, but so do several factors that operate somewhat independently:

Sleep. Short and fragmented sleep is associated with increased visceral accumulation, partly through effects on appetite-regulating hormones and cortisol.

Chronic stress. Sustained cortisol elevation appears to favor visceral deposition specifically.

Alcohol. Both through calories and through direct effects on liver fat metabolism.

Physical inactivity. Independent of weight. Sedentary people accumulate visceral fat faster than active people at the same body weight.

Age and hormonal change. Fat distribution shifts across the lifespan. In women, the menopausal transition is commonly associated with a shift from hip and thigh storage toward abdominal storage, which is part of why cardiometabolic risk changes during that period.

Genetics. Where you preferentially store fat has a substantial hereditary component.

Measuring it

Waist circumference is the practical option. Measure at the level of the navel, at the end of a normal exhale, with the tape snug but not compressing. Track it monthly.

Waist-to-height ratio is a useful refinement — a common rule of thumb suggests keeping your waist under half your height, which scales sensibly across body sizes.

DEXA and MRI can quantify visceral fat directly. DEXA is widely available and gives a reliable regional breakdown; MRI is more precise and less practical.

The encouraging part

Visceral fat responds well to intervention. It’s often among the first fat to mobilize when someone increases activity and improves diet quality, and meaningful reductions can occur before body weight changes much at all.

This is worth knowing, because it means the scale can stay flat while something genuinely useful is happening. If your waist is shrinking and your weight isn’t, you’re losing the fat that matters and holding onto the tissue you want.

Which is, in nearly every case, exactly the right trade.
